Written as a symphony for unaccompanied voices, George Lynn composed Sacred Symphony No. 1 in four movements (1958), of which Sing unto the Lord a New Song is the 3rd movement. Calling for SATB forces, this work was commissioned by and dedicated to the Harding College A Capella Choir, Kenneth Davis, director. George Lynn conducted the Sacred Symphony premiere performance, March 21, 1959. For church, high school, community and college choirs. Medium difficulty.
